site stats

Implement a simple web crawler

WitrynaIn the previous chapter we have implemented a very simple breadth-first crawler with the aim of constructing a link network from Wikipedia pages. The tools used for the … Witryna28 sty 2024 · Build a scalable web crawler with Selenium and Python by Philipp Postels Towards Data Science An implementation within the Google Cloud Platform by using Docker, Kubernetes Engine and Cloud Datastore. Open in app Sign up Sign In Write Sign up Sign In Published in Towards Data Science Philipp Postels Follow Jan 28, …

How to Build a Web Crawler in Python from Scratch

Witryna28 maj 2024 · For this simple web crawler, we will identify URLs by targeting anchor tags in a webpage’s HTML. This will be accomplished by creating a subclass of … Witryna28 cze 2024 · It is a Python library for pulling data out of HTML and XML files. Step 1: Installing the required third-party libraries Easiest way to install external libraries in python is to use pip. pip is a package management system used to install and manage software packages written in Python. All you need to do is: peanuts christmas paper plates https://ssbcentre.com

Step-by-step Guide to Build a Web Crawler for Beginners

Witryna20 kwi 2024 · After I obtain all the links on the main page, I am trying to implement a depth-first and breadth-first search to find 100 additional links. Currently, I have scraped and obtained the links on the main page. Now I need help implement the depth-first and breadth-first aspect of my crawler. I believe my web crawler is doing a depth-first … WitrynaMake them searchable. Run CrawlerMain, either from Visual Studio after opening the .sln file, or from the command line after compiling using msbuild. You will need to pass a few command-line arguments, such as your search service information and the root URL of the site you'd like to crawl. Witryna12 sie 2024 · 1. General-Purpose Web Crawler. A general-purpose Web crawler, as the name suggests, gathers as many pages as it can from a particular set of URLs to … lightroom cc unlocked version download

Web Crawler in Python - Topcoder

Category:How to Build a Simple Web Crawler in Python - Medium

Tags:Implement a simple web crawler

Implement a simple web crawler

How to Build a Simple Web Crawler in Python - Medium

Witryna9 wrz 2024 · We will create a list named crawling:to_visit and push the starting URL. Then we will go into a loop that will query that list for items and block for a minute until an item is ready. When an item is retrieved, we call … Witryna25 sty 2024 · The basic workflow of a general web crawler is as follows: Get the initial URL. The initial URL is an entry point for the web crawler, which links to the web …

Implement a simple web crawler

Did you know?

Witryna29 wrz 2016 · Start out the project by making a very basic scraper that uses Scrapy as its foundation. To do that, you’ll need to create a Python class that subclasses scrapy.Spider, a basic spider class provided by Scrapy. This class will have two required attributes: name — just a name for the spider. start_urls — a list of URLs that you … WitrynaThe Abot crawler is configured by the method Crawler.CreateCrawlConfiguration, which you can adjust to your liking. Code overview. CrawlerMain contains the setup …

http://www.netinstructions.com/how-to-make-a-simple-web-crawler-in-java/ Witryna3 paź 2024 · crawler4j is an open source web crawler for Java which provides a simple interface for crawling the Web. Using it, you can setup a multi-threaded web crawler in few minutes. Table of content Installation Quickstart More Examples Configuration Details License Installation Using Maven Add the following dependency to your pom.xml:

WitrynaTrack crawling progress. If the website is small, it is not a problem. Contrarily it might be very frustrating if you crawl half of the site and it failed. Consider using a database or a filesystem to store the progress. Be kind to the site owners. If you are ever going to use your crawler outside of your website, you have to use delays. Witryna29 wrz 2016 · This is a simple web crawler which visits a given initial web page, scrapes all the links from the page and adds them to a Queue (LinkedList), where …

Witryna28 cze 2024 · Step 1: Installing the required third-party libraries. Easiest way to install external libraries in python is to use pip. pip is a package management system used …

Witryna17 lut 2024 · Implement a webpage Crawler to crawl webpages of http://www.wikipedia.org/. To simplify the question, let's use url instead of the the webpage content. Your crawler should: Call HtmlHelper.parseUrls (url) to get all urls from a webpage of given url. Only crawl the webpage of wikipedia. Do not crawl the … lightroom cc to lightroom classicWitryna22 cze 2024 · Web scraping lets you collect data from web pages across the internet. It's also called web crawling or web data extraction. PHP is a widely used back-end scripting language for creating dynamic websites and web applications. And you can implement a web scraper using plain PHP code. peanuts christmas picsWitrynaIn this video, we shall develop a simple web crawler in Python (using regular expressions) that will crawl a book store website and extract all product infor... peanuts christmas pillowWitryna17 lut 2024 · Implement a webpage Crawler to crawl webpages of http://www.wikipedia.org/. To simplify the question, let's use url instead of the the … peanuts christmas party decorationsWitryna18 cze 2012 · If the page running the crawler script is on www.example.com, then that script can crawl all the pages on www.example.com, but not the pages of any other origin (unless some edge case applies, e.g., the Access-Control-Allow-Origin header is set for pages on the other server). lightroom cc time lapse presetsWitryna22 cze 2024 · Web scraping lets you collect data from web pages across the internet. It's also called web crawling or web data extraction. PHP is a widely used back-end … peanuts christmas pictures downloadWitrynaScheduler. Just make sure there's only one instance running (by way of a mutex). An easy way to do this is to attempt to obtain a write-lock on a blob (there can only be … lightroom cc tutorials free